CSS特性
2019-03-30 本文已影响211人
辽A丶孙悟空
一、CSS3 图像的背景
- 背景图片设定
- background
- CSS允许应用纯色作为背景,也允许使用背景图像创建相当复杂的效果。
- background-size规定背景图片的尺寸。
- background-size:cover
- cover把背景图片扩展至足够大,以使背景图像完全覆盖背景区域。
- 背景图像的某些部分也许无法显示在背景定位区域中。
- contain把图像扩展至最大尺寸,以使其宽度和高度完全适应内容区域。
二、CSS 颜色
- 颜色
- 十六进制色background-color:#0000ff
- RGB颜色:rgb(255,0,0)
- RGBA颜色:rgba(255,0,0,0.5)
- HSL颜色:hsl(120,65%,75%)
- HSLA颜色:hsla(120,65%,75%,0.3)
三、图像透明
- 透明
- CSS创建透明图像
- 注释:CSS opacity属性是W3C CSS推荐标准的一部分。
- filter:alpha(opacity=XX)是IE滤镜
四、颜色的渐变
- 渐变
- 渐变可以创建类似于彩虹的效果,低版本的浏览器不得不使用开发者用图片来实现,CSS3将会轻松实现网页渐变效果
- background:-webkit-linear-gradient(#ffffff,#000000)
五、图像的边框
- 个性化边框
- CSS3新增三个边框属性
- border-radius:圆角边框
- box-shadow:边框阴影
- border-image:图片边框
- IE9+支持圆角和阴影
六、阴影
- 阴影
- 在CSS3中,box-shadow用于向方框加阴影
语法
box-shadow:h-shadow v-shadow blur spread color inset;
box-shadow:0px 1px 3px rgba(0,0,0.35)
![]()